In the Kupiansk direction, Ukrainian forces cleared about 2 km² of forest

The Defense Forces liberated an area to the southwest of Zakhidne and are advancing west from Dvorichna

Ukrainian forces conducted an infantry operation on the Kupiansk direction and cleared about 2 square kilometers of forested area. This is stated in a report by the Institute for the Study of War (ISW).

The «Khartia» corps reported that its fighters liberated a sector southwest of Zakhidne. Ukrainian forces are also continuing to advance west of Dvorichna in Kharkiv Oblast.

The unit released geolocated video showing 1520 Ukrainian servicemen running through the forest. ISW analysts assessed that a group up to platoon-sized may have taken part in the operation.

“Ukrainian troops operated freely in open terrain, indicating the suppression of Russian drones in the area,” the ISW noted.

Earlier Ukrainian forces captured 7.5 square kilometers of woodlands southwest of Dvorichna and advanced north of Zakhidne. This was aided by strikes on concentrations of Russian troops, unmanned ground vehicles, radars, electronic warfare systems and strike drones of the “Molniya” type.

Analysts reminded that since 2025 both sides have been trying to restore tactical maneuver capability. Recent counterattacks and operations to suppress Russia’s drone defenses may be part of those efforts.

ISW also noted that in May Ukrainian forces liberated more territory than the Russian army was able to capture.
